Based in our Sutherland Office, you will be reporting to the Associate Structural Engineer where you will be given the opportunity to be involved in all aspects of concept and detailed design and documentation on a diverse range of projects, whilst taking responsibility for your projects expanding your portfolio.

As a Senior Structural Design Engineer, you will be responsible to:

• Attend client and stakeholder design meetings;

• Produce, review and check designs in accordance with relevant design standards and codes;

• Preparing details project plans, including budgets, time forcasts and resource planning;

• Preparation and submission of tenders and proposals;

• Provide a comprehensive structural engineering design service to clients;

• Building Key client relationships;

• Manage numerous projects to programme and budget;

• Work collaboratively within a multi-disciplinary environment; and

• Mentor junior team members.

Your experience will include:

• Engineering degree in structural or civil engineering;

• Minimum 5 years’ post-graduate engineering consultancy experience;

• Chartered Structural Engineer or close to achieving Chartered status;

• A self-motivated, technically strong and competent individual able to work independently and also lead and direct a group of engineers and drafters;

• Able to build and maintain effective client relationships; and

• Excellent communication and report writing skills.
